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

A method for predictive migration of active memory during virtual machine migration

A virtual machine migration and virtual machine technology, applied in the field of virtual machine migration, can solve problems such as incomplete memory, page fault, virtual machine hang, etc., and achieve the effect of improving migration efficiency

Active Publication Date: 2022-06-07
宁波谦川科技有限公司
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The disadvantage of post-copy migration is that the memory of the virtual machine is not complete when it resumes running on the destination host, and page faults often occur due to access to memory pages that have not been migrated, causing the virtual machine to be suspended
There is a network delay between sending a page fault request to the host host and getting the missing page, resulting in a decline in the working performance of the virtual machine after recovery

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method for predictive migration of active memory during virtual machine migration
  • A method for predictive migration of active memory during virtual machine migration
  • A method for predictive migration of active memory during virtual machine migration

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0051] The specific embodiments of the present invention will be described in further detail below with reference to the accompanying drawings and embodiments. The following examples are intended to illustrate the present invention, but not to limit the scope of the present invention.

[0052] like figure 1 As shown, the method of this embodiment is as follows.

[0053] Step 1: Use the pre-recording algorithm to migrate the virtual machine, keep the virtual machine running normally during the process of migrating the core data of the virtual machine, and the virtual machine manager will record the address and access time of the memory accessed during this period. This stage is called the pre-recording stage, the recorded memory pages are called pre-recorded pages, and the set formed by the pre-recorded pages is called the pre-recorded page set. In the pre-recording stage, whenever the guest virtual machine performs read and write access to the memory, the virtual machine man...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method for predicting and migrating active memory in the process of virtual machine migration, which belongs to the technical field of virtual machine migration. The method first records the address of the visited memory and the pre-recorded page set composed of the visited time recorded by the virtual machine manager. Use the method of six-tuple to represent each memory page for preprocessing, then calculate the priority weight of the memory page, and use the ISS-DBSCAN clustering algorithm for cluster analysis to determine the active memory range. Finally, the priority weight of the memory page is used as the basis for judging the priority, and the sending order of the active memory pages is adjusted. The method of the invention provides a theoretical basis and a method for active memory analysis, can effectively predict the activity degree of memory pages, and improve the efficiency of memory migration.

Description

technical field [0001] The invention relates to the technical field of virtual machine migration, in particular to a method for predicting and migrating active memory during virtual machine migration. Background technique [0002] With the generation of big data, today's world has entered an era of data explosion. Although the performance of computer hardware has developed rapidly, computing power is still the bottleneck of applications. Cloud computing constitutes a high-performance, high-utilization, high-reliability computing cluster by providing a configurable computing resource sharing pool. The scale is dynamically scalable, which brings infinite possibilities to computing and can satisfy the growing number of users. size and mission requirements. In order to achieve this unlimited computing power, cloud computing platforms need to provide completely isolated operating environments for different users, dynamically allocate massive computing resources and solve the pro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/455
CPCG06F9/45558G06F2009/4557G06F2009/45583
Inventor 乔建忠单中元张之敏林树宽李昇智张强赵廷磊
Owner 宁波谦川科技有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products